House Flipper VR Hits PlayStation VR Next Month

By Joseph Allen

Frozen Way has announced that House Flipper VR is making its way to PlayStation VR next month.

House Flipper VR is hitting PS VR on August 11th, bringing the much-loved home renovation sim to the PS4 and its virtual reality headset.

Bear in mind this is a release for PS VR and not PS VR2, and since PS VR games aren't compatible with PS VR2, you'll need an original PS VR headset to play House Flipper VR on PlayStation.

If you've got one, though, you'll be able to check out a revamped version of House Flipper built specifically for VR, complete with "redefined" mechanics and plenty of renovations to complete.

As well as renovating homes, you can also look forward to a variety of minigames, including basketball, darts, and remote-controlled car racing.

Of course, if you don't want to engage with silly frippery like that, there's also lots of renovation to be done, and you can get stuck into activities like painting, cleaning, and wall puttying with an added layer of immersion thanks to PlayStation VR.

It's also worth noting that this isn't a simple re-release of House Flipper in VR; rather, it's a redesigned version of the game, so even if you've already played and enjoyed House Flipper, you may well find something new to love in this VR version.

If you're looking to pick up House Flipper VR on PS4, you're going to need a PS VR headset and a PlayStation Camera, so make sure you've got the right equipment before you make your purchase.
